I would like to book a hunt for dangerous game...something that could concievably hunt back.
I don' t know what game to look for nor wher to go for an outfitter.
I have thought of Brown bear, Tiger, Lion..any help is appreaciated

' 69,
Sounds like a honest and unpretentious request. You are at an exciting junction. You' re talking some heavy duty adventure and that in turn attracts a heavy duty crowd. You' re looking at some $$$ and some trade offs to be weighed in your quest for dangerous game.

Try http://www.accuratereloading.com.

Go onto the African game forum. The hunting trip brokers cruise those waters and can fill you in on dangerous game hunts all over the world (Atkinson, an old sage, is one). You will need a grip on three items: money, time, and mental toughness. Come on plain and honest and they will give you a load of help. A word of caution though, they have no tolerance for BS' ers --- pretenders can get cut to pieces. Just like what can happen in the bush.
